Elsewhere, Luhrmann describes another moment on set where the music made the sequence work.

They were filming a night scene set on Memphis’s Beale Street where Elvis goes to visit B.B.

King (Kelvin Harrison Jr.), and something was not clicking.

So he asked one of his crew to blastKanye West’s"Black Skinhead" across the set.

It feels like ‘Black Skinhead’ by Kanye West."

Harrison, who portrays B.B.

King, remembers that moment making him come alive.

Now I can actually act,'" he laughs.

“Because otherwise, I was just like, ‘Well this is stale.’
